Subject: Welcome to on-call — autoscaler notes

Hi Priya,

Welcome to the Quenby support rotation. The most common page you'll see involves the queue-depth autoscaler for the Larkspur ingest pipeline. It scales workers based on a five-minute rolling average of pending jobs, so brief spikes are normal — don't intervene unless depth stays above 10k for fifteen minutes. If it does, check recent deploys before touching scaling limits manually. The full runbook, including escalation thresholds and override steps, lives on our internal wiki here.

wiki page, tahaf-tajog: https://jira.ordindyn.corp/pipeline

**CI note: timezone weirdness in report exports**

Heads up, support folks — if a customer says their Ledgerpine export shows times shifted by a few hours, it's probably the CI image. The export workers got rebuilt last week and the base image defaults to UTC, while older workers used the account's locale. Fix is rolling out; meanwhile tell customers the data itself is fine, just the display offset. Affected exports carry the build token shown below.

build token for bajof-tahop: htk4_a981

During last night's audit we found the staging update channel for Emberline devices no longer matches the declared baseline. Roughly a third of the fleet is pinned to the beta channel with a shortened rollout delay, likely left over from the August canary test. This explains the uneven firmware versions reported by the Halewick dashboard. Please reconcile before the next scheduled push; devices on the wrong channel will receive the unsigned beta build. The intended baseline values are as follows:

service settings:
[casix]
port = 7000
team = belix
host = casix.xolmardata.internal
region = east-1
access_code = ac_714b3a
timeout_ms = 1500